The video emphasizes the importance of focusing on science, particularly microbial ecology, for those interested in environmental issues. It highlights the significant role microbes play in the world and suggests that understanding them can help us balance ecological systems. Additionally, the video encourages learning diverse skills such as journalism, acting, anthropology, and languages to broaden perspectives and improve communication.
